Specifically I am trying to change the color of my feature polygon based on its relation to today's date (if possible). The scenario is this: I am trying to track lease expirations for numerous properties. If a date from the attribute table (Lease Expiration date) is equal to or before today's date (the lease is expired) I would like the polygon color to change to black from red, green or whatever I decide it to be.
Yes, you can do this via a custom Expression in Symbology.
In the webmap, open symbology for the layer, in the attribute to symbolize, scroll all the way to the bottom of the list and create a custom expression. The custom expression could be something like this:
// Symbolize by Expired
var age
var Expired
// Difference between feature attribute and today
age = DateDiff(Now(),$feature.ExpirationDate,'days')
//Is it expired or not?
Expired = iif(age<0, 'Not Expired','Expired')
//Sybolize on this value
return Expired
That should get you close to a solution.
